The driver-assignment heuristic bundle for Routewise fails verification on deploy to the Calder staging cluster. The pipeline builds the bundle correctly, but the verifier rejects it with a key mismatch. Root cause: the heuristic service was rebuilt after last month's rotation and the reviewer-facing docs still reference the retired key. Fix is a one-line config change plus doc update; please confirm the logic in verify_bundle.go matches. For reference, the currently valid signing key is below.

rollout seal: bky4_x7Gc

Action item (P1, owner: feeds team): The Garrick Street garage occupancy feed stalled for 40 minutes because stale-sensor detection never fired — the threshold was set for the old Lotwatch hardware, not the new Curbline sensors, which report every 15s instead of 60s. Support saw "full" counts frozen at peak. Fix is to retune staleness and backoff values and alert on gaps over two intervals. Until the patch ships, restart the poller manually if counts freeze. Apply the following constants to the poller config:

tuning constants:
TIERS = {
    "sorion": 670,
    "istax": 547,
}

Onboarding note for the Ledgerpane admin table: bulk edits are applied through the batcher service, not directly against the database. Select rows, choose an action, and the batcher stages changes in a pending set you can review before commit. Edits over 500 rows require a second approver — this is enforced server-side, so don't try to chunk around it. To run the batcher locally you need the staging write credential, which goes in your .env as the next line.

secret setting of bahip-kagag: RELAY_SECRET3=c83

Handing off the Quillbus broker upgrade (4.x to 5.1) to Dario. Cluster is half-migrated; mixed-version mode is supported but TLS cert rotation must finish before cutover. No auth model changes, though the admin API gained two new endpoints worth reviewing. Open questions and the migration checklist are tracked on the internal page below.

dashboard of taduf-bawef = https://jira.lumicsys.internal/projects/display/browse/b1cbf89d